Mark Teixeira's injury more serious  —  TAMPA, Fla. — The injury that will keep New York Yankees first baseman Mark Teixeira out of the lineup until May at the earliest is not a wrist strain, as originally reported, but a partially torn tendon sheath that could potentially require season-ending surgery.

MLB, MLBPA Talking Worldwide Draft  —  1:26pm: Rob Manfred, MLB's executive VP, said there's a chance of a deal by June 1st, Liz Mullen of the Sports Business Journal reports (on Twitter).  The most likely outcomes are a single global draft or the current draft plus a second draft for international players, Mullen reports.
